Where are you riding ... is it dusty, gritty, sandy, muddy ..... I've only just learnt how much crap you can pick up in the summer with too much wet lube it was literally caked on the chain, cassette and jockey wheels and I'm sure it'd shorten it's life dramatically if I hadn't of realised and cleaned it off.

Some people set a regime of using the 3 chains ... run the 1st 2 until they've stretched to 0.5 and the 3rd until it's stretched to 0.75 and then go back and use the 1st two until they hit 0.75 .... supposedly this gives you the max usage out of your chains and cassette.
